Understanding Marketing Open Courses
What is a Marketing Open Course?
A marketing open course refers to online or in-person classes that are freely available for anyone to enroll. This inclusive approach allows individuals from diverse backgrounds to gain insights into marketing strategies, tools, and trends. Typically, these courses cover a broad range of topics tailored to the evolving marketing landscape.
As an aspiring marketer, these courses can introduce you to fundamental concepts like digital marketing, content marketing, SEO, and social media strategy. The structure of these classes helps facilitate learning at your own pace, making it easier to absorb the material.
Types of Marketing Open Courses
Marketing open courses come in various forms, including MOOCs (Massive Open Online Courses), webinars, and community college offerings. Each type has its nuances, catering to different learning preferences and time commitments. MOOCs are particularly popular, as they are often structured with video lectures, readings, and discussion forums.
Community colleges may offer free courses with hands-on opportunities, allowing you to practice what you’ve learned in real-time. It’s essential to consider your learning style when selecting a course type, as some may prefer self-paced learning while others benefit from interactive settings.
Topics Covered in Marketing Open Courses
Typically, a marketing open course will cover a wide range of essential topics. From understanding market research to social media engagement, these courses equip you with a diverse skill set. You will often explore the fundamentals of target audience identification and brand positioning strategies.
Advanced topics such as analytics, email marketing, and conversion rate optimization may also be included. As you progress through these subjects, you’ll develop a well-rounded knowledge base that will serve as a strong foundation for your marketing career.
How Marketing Open Courses are Structured
These courses often follow a flexible structure that includes various learning methods such as video lectures, readings, quizzes, and assignments. This format not only caters to different learning styles but also keeps engagement high. Furthermore, many courses include peer interaction through discussion boards, fostering community and collaboration.
Each course may vary significantly in duration, with some lasting just a few weeks and others extending over several months. By understanding the structure before enrolling, you can choose a course that fits your schedule and learning preferences.

How to Choose the Right Marketing Open Course
Identifying Your Goals
Before selecting a marketing open course, it’s essential to define your learning objectives. Are you looking to brush up on specific skills or gain a comprehensive overview of the marketing field? Understanding your goals will help narrow down options effectively.
With a clear vision of what you want to achieve, you can assess courses that align with your aspirations. This focused approach increases the likelihood of a rewarding learning experience.
Evaluating Course Content
When considering a marketing open course, be sure to review the course syllabus and learning outcomes. Check whether the topics covered resonate with your goals and interests. You may want to look for courses that offer both foundational knowledge and advanced strategies.
Reading reviews and testimonials from previous students can provide insights into the quality of the course content. This feedback can guide your decision-making process significantly.
Instructor Credentials and Experience
Who teaches the course matters greatly. Research the instructors’ credentials, industry experience, and teaching style. A knowledgeable instructor can enhance your learning experience immensely, providing valuable insights based on their real-world experiences.
Instructors who encourage interaction and provide constructive feedback can help facilitate a more enriching learning environment, which is especially beneficial in marketing where practical knowledge is vital.
Considering Time Commitments
Finally, be realistic about the time you can dedicate to a marketing open course. Some courses require significant commitment, while others offer more flexibility. Ensure the course matches your schedule so you can fully engage without feeling overwhelmed.
By picking a course that matches your availability, you can enhance your learning experience and avoid unnecessary stress. Balancing course work with your other responsibilities is crucial for a positive experience.
